Pupils from Summerfield Primary School in Newport have taken time to produce some festive decorations for their local supermarket.
Year 3 Australia Class have worked hard to produce Christmas decorations for Sainsbury’s ‘Goods Online Trolleys’ for the superstore in Newport.
Paul Dyer, Store Manager, said:
“Every year we ask a school if they would like to help us in making Sainsbury’s Newport look decorative and this year children from our local Primary, Summerfields Primary School certainly did that.
“They made some really great festive pieces of artwork for our Goods Online Trolleys, which are all very busy at the moment as they get used for all our Customers Home Delivery orders before Christmas.
“My colleagues and I would like to thank Year 3 Australia Class, for all their hard work and wish them all at Summerfields a very Merry Christmas”.
